site stats

Lazy binomial heap

Web23 jan. 2024 · Lazy binomial heap. We can go a bit further and make our binomial heap lazy. This will help us improve the amortized time of some of the operations. The only … WebIn computer science, a Fibonacci heap is a data structure for priority queue operations, consisting of a collection of heap-ordered trees.It has a better amortized running time …

Rank-Pairing Heaps - Semantic Scholar

Web7 apr. 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说 … In computer science, a binomial heap is a data structure that acts as a priority queue but also allows pairs of heaps to be merged. It is important as an implementation of the mergeable heap abstract data type (also called meldable heap), which is a priority queue supporting merge operation. It is implemented as a heap similar to a binary heap but using a special tree structure that is different from the complete binary trees used by binary heaps. Binomial heaps were invented in 1978 by J… gwyl machynlleth https://smiths-ca.com

Binomial heap - Wikipedia

Web20 feb.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ebThe learning with errors (LWE) problem is one of the main mathematical foundations of post-quantum cryptography. One of the main groups of algorithms for solving LWE is the Blum–Kalai–Wasserman (BKW) algorithm. This paper presents new improvements of BKW-style algorithms for solving LWE instances. We target minimum concrete complexity, and … WebLazy binomial heap: decrease-key, amortized complexity Fibonacci heap: insert, delete-min and decrease-key, amortized complexity 5. lecture on 3.11. Applications of heaps in … boys gacha club outfits

Lecture 4 September 20, 2024 - University of Hawaiʻi

Category:Let’s Build a Min Heap - Medium

Tags:Lazy binomial heap

Lazy binomial heap

二项堆(binomial heap)的源代码 - CSDN

WebDownload Learning Path:Learning Functional Data Structure & Algorithm or any other file from Video Courses category. HTTP download also available at fast speeds. WebLazy Binomial Queues Theorem The amortized time for an operation on a one-pass or multipass binomial queue is O(1) for a make-heap, find-min, insert or meld, and …

Lazy binomial heap

Did you know?

WebCreating Heap. Binomial Queues: Binomial Queue Operations, Binomial Amortized Analysis, Lazy Binomial Queues 1 A B 2 A B 3 A B 4 A B ... A explain the procedure for … Webhttp://www.cp.eng.chula.ac.th/faculty/spj Amortized Thinking Union violates binomial heaps structural property Let the Extract-Min convert the lazy version back

WebAt the end of the process, we obtain a non-lazy binomial heap containing at most log. n. trees,at most one of each degree. Worst case cost – O(n) Amortized cost – O(log. n) … Web在 计算机科学 中, 二项堆 ( binomial heap )是一种类似于 二叉堆 的 堆结构 。 与二叉堆相比,其优势是可以快速合并两个堆,因此它属于可合并堆( mergeable heap ) 抽象 …

Web14 apr. 2024 · C#实现:二项分布算法Binomial Distribution(含源代码) 在Main函数中,我们设置了试验次数n为10,成功概率p为0.5,并用循环计算每个成功次数k的概率。 二项分布,也称为伯努利分布,是统计学中常见的一种离散概率分布,常用于描述在n次独立的伯努利试验中成功次数的概率分布。 Web* The two key features of binomial heaps are: * * 1. The roots of the forest are <= log(n) * 2. Merging two heaps is binary addition * * This brings merge() from O(n + m) to O(logn + …

WebData Structures in Typescript #19 - Lazy Binomial Heap Intro Part 1 of 2 Jeff Zhang 1.85K subscribers Subscribe 1.5K views 2 years ago Data Structures in Typescript Data …

WebBinomial Heap - 二項式堆積 (Algo.) Def: 此堆積是由 Degree 0 的樹依序堆積下去 Degree 為 0 的二項樹只有一個 Root Root 下有 k k 個 Child,每個 Child Degree分別為 k−1,k−2,...,2,1,0 k − 1, k − 2,..., 2, 1, 0 可將二項樹視為 Height 從 0 開始的樹,其 N odes = 2k N o d e s = 2 k (即為前一棵的 2 2 倍) 高度或 Degree 為 k k 的二項樹,它在 Height 為 … boys game online pokiWebAnimation Speed: w: h: Algorithm Visualizations boys galoshes bootsWeb22 jun. 2024 · Lazy binomial heap——python实现前言functionslazy mergeinsertextractMincoalesce_stepupdateMin关于decreaseKey的问题前言完整的资 … gwyl wrightWeb24 mrt. 2024 · In previous post i.e. Set 1 we have discussed that implements these below functions:. insert(H, k): Inserts a key ‘k’ to Binomial Heap ‘H’. This operation first creates … gwyl y baban caryl parry jonesWebPart B: Lazy Binomial Heaps (35 marks) Each public method (Insert, Remove and Front) of the Binomial Heap seen in class takes O(log n) time. However, if we relax the condition … boys galleriesWebLazy Binomial Heaps An arbitrary list of binomial trees (possibly n trees of size 1) Pointer to root with minimal key . 32 45 67 40 58 20 31 15 35 9 33 10 Pointer to root with … boys game chairWebThere are three main implementations of priority queues: the first employs a binary heap, typically one which uses a sequence; the second uses a tree (or forest of trees), which is typically less structured than an associative container's tree; the third simply uses an associative container. boys game on poki